Effectiveness and Performance Comparison



When contrasting air resource and ground source heatpump for effectiveness and efficiency, it's essential to take into consideration how each system operates in different problems. Air resource heat pumps extract warmth from the outside air, making them a lot more susceptible to fluctuations in temperature level. This suggests they could be less reliable in very cool climates.

On the other hand, ground resource heatpump use stable below ground temperatures for warmth exchange, offering even more consistent efficiency no matter outside weather. Ground source heatpump are generally much more energy-efficient in the long run due to the steady warm source underground. In addition, ground source heat pumps often tend to have a much longer life-span compared to air resource heat pumps, which might impact long-term performance and upkeep prices.

Environmental Effect Analysis



Analyzing the environmental influence of air resource and ground resource heatpump is vital in recognizing their sustainability.

Air source heatpump call for electricity to operate, which can cause increased carbon discharges if the electricity comes from fossil fuels. On the other hand, ground source heat pumps use the stable temperature level of the ground to warm and cool your home, leading to reduced power intake and decreased greenhouse gas exhausts.

The installment of both types of heat pumps includes some level of ecological impact, such as using refrigerants in air resource heatpump or the excavation required for ground loopholes in ground source heatpump. However, ground resource heatpump have a longer life expectancy and higher effectiveness, making them a more environmentally friendly alternative in the future.
